Demystifying iOS: Your iPhone's Brain
Let's kick things off with iOS. If you're an i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ch user, you're already familiar with it. But what exactly is iOS? Well, put simply, it's the operating system that powers all those sleek Apple devices. Think of it as the brain of your phone – it manages everything from the user interface and app functionality to the underlying hardware. iOS is known for its user-friendly design, security features, and seamless integration with Apple's ecosystem. It's constantly evolving, with new versions released regularly to enhance performance, add features, and address security vulnerabilities. The beauty of iOS lies in its simplicity. Apple's commitment to user experience shines through in every aspect, from the intuitive touch controls to the elegant design. This ease of use is a major factor in iOS's popularity, making it accessible to users of all ages and technical backgrounds. Behind the scenes, however, iOS is a complex piece of software. It's built upon a foundation of Unix-based technologies, providing a robust and secure environment for apps to run. The App Store, a curated marketplace for applications, is another key component of the iOS experience. It provides users with a vast library of apps, carefully vetted by Apple to ensure quality and security. The consistent updates and rigorous app review process contribute to iOS's reputation for stability and reliability. iOS also boasts a strong focus on privacy. Apple has implemented numerous features to protect user data, including end-to-end encryption for iMessages, and privacy controls that allow users to manage what information apps can access. This commitment to privacy is a major differentiator in a world where data security is increasingly important. The media landscape has undergone a massive transformation in recent years. Traditional news sources, like newspapers and television, are still around, but they're now competing with a vast array of online platforms, social media, and independent bloggers. News is no longer a one-way street; it's a dynamic conversation, shaped by user-generated content, citizen journalism, and instant updates. Understanding the news landscape is more important than ever. With so much information available, it can be challenging to sift through the noise and find reliable sources. This is where media literacy comes in. It's the ability to critically evaluate the information you consume, to identify biases, and to distinguish between fact and opinion. The rise of social media has significantly impacted how we consume news. Platforms like Twitter, Facebook, and Instagram have become primary sources of information for many people. While these platforms offer instant access to breaking news, they also pose challenges, such as the spread of misinformation and the echo chamber effect, where users are primarily exposed to information that confirms their existing beliefs. Navigating this complex landscape requires a critical approach to news consumption. Always consider the source of the information, look for corroborating evidence from multiple sources, and be aware of potential biases. Being informed is a right, but it also comes with the responsibility of being a discerning consumer of information.
